One person is dead and several others were injured after a gunman, who shouted "Free Palestine", opened fire on a wedding party at a New Hampshire country club.

Attorney General John Formella and Nashua Police Chief Kevin Rourke said the person who died at the Sky Meadow Country Club in Nashua was an adult male. 

The male suspect was detained at the scene. 

Five or six shots were said to have been fired fired by a "crazed gunman" who was stopped when someone hit him over the head with a chair.

Guests had gathered on the dance floor when the shooting started.

Those caught up in the shooting were forced to run or lock themselves in a nearby room.

Sophie Flabouris, a teacher from Massachusetts, said it was the "scariest moment of her life."

Aerial video from WMUR-TV showed multiple emergency responders heading to the scene. 

U.S. Rep. Maggie Goodlander said in a statement that she was "closely monitoring the tragic reports of a shooting tonight at Sky Meadow Country Club in Nashua" and that her heart was with the victims, their families and the entire community. 

Nashua is about 45 miles (70 kilometres) northwest of Boston, just across the Massachusetts border.
